Ticket: Staging env misconfigured for Siftgate bloom filter

The bloom layer in front of the Pellet KV store is rejecting all lookups in staging because the env file was copied from the dev template without credentials. False-positive tuning values are fine; only the auth line is missing. To unblock the weekly demo, the Pellet admission secret must be set on the following line.

env line for yaguf-fajop: LEDGER_TOKEN13=fb08984397349

**Finance Review Summary – Training Budget**

Quick one before you take over: next year's training budget sits at 4% above this year, mostly earmarked for the Lanternside leadership course. We trimmed external conference spend — nobody missed it. Approvals route through Soren until January. There's one thing you should know that hasn't gone wider yet.

internal memo for kaduf-baduf: Only 35 of the 378 pilot accounts renewed Holir, so a churn review is set for June 11. Eliielax Group is in early talks to buy Silaelix Group for about $142.1 million.

**Ticket: Config drift on BounceSift processor**

The email bounce processor in the Larkfield environment has drifted from the values committed in the release branch. Retry windows and suppression thresholds no longer match, which likely explains the duplicate suppression entries reported Tuesday. Please reconcile before the Thursday cut. For reference, the currently deployed configuration on the live node reads as follows.

config for yajep-yahof:
[briax]
port = 9200
region = outer-2
host = briax.nelvrocorp.test
team = raleth
timeout_ms = 1500
retries = 1